Learn some lessons in good living from the Bible’s bad news belles. Women everywhere marvel at the “good girls” in Scripture such as Sarah, Mary, and Ruth. But on most days, when they look in the mirror they see the selfishness of Sapphira or the deception of Delilah. They catch a glimpse of Jezebel’s take-charge pride or Salome’s misguided attempt to please her mother. What’s a good girl to do?

In Bad Girls of the Bible, author Liz Curtis Higgs offers a unique and clear-sighted approach to understanding those “other women” in Scripture, combining a contemporary retelling of their stories with a solid, verse-by-verse study of the lessons we can learn from them. Whether they were “bad to the bone,” “bad for a season,” or just “bad for a moment,” these infamous sisters show readers how not to handle life’s challenges. With her trademark humor and encouragement, Liz Curtis Higgs helps us avoid their tragic mistakes and joyfully embrace grace.
